If a "Stay aboard the Queen Mary for an experience unlike any other." is for you, board the Queen Mary Hotel for an experience unlike any other. Once a world-class ocean liner, the Queen Mary, now permanently stationed in Long Beach, offers a real glimpse into what transatlantic travel was like during the 30s, 40s and 50s. With its impressive history and tradition of excellence, the ship is more than just a place to rest one’s head. It’s also a place where you can take historic tours, see paranormal attractions, browse shops, relax on the spacious sun deck or enjoy fresh seafood at Chelsea Chowder House & Bar. Even in the rooms you’ll find an impressive history, rich tradition and old world elegance. The ship’s 346 original first-class staterooms and nine suites, adorned with rich wood paneling from all over the world, Art Deco built-ins and original artwork found on the ship during her heyday, all pay homage to a bygone era. Enjoy one of the last luxury ocean liners of its kind.
